The Bengali Language Movement in 1952 the East Bengali legislative election, 19 Pakistani coup d'état the Six point movement of 1966 and the 1970 Pakistani general election resulted in the rise of Bengali nationalism and pro-democracy movements in East Pakistan. It was renamed as East Pakistan with Dhaka becoming the country's legislative capital. In 1947, East Bengal became the most populous province in the Dominion of Pakistan. A referendum and the announcement of the Radcliffe Line established the present-day territorial boundary of Bangladesh. Prior to the partition of Bengal, the Prime Minister of Bengal proposed a Bengali sovereign state. In 1940, the first Prime Minister of Bengal supported the Lahore Resolution with the hope of creating a state in eastern South Asia. The creation of Eastern Bengal and Assam in 1905 set a precedent for the emergence of Bangladesh. The Bengal Presidency grew into the largest administrative unit in British India. In 1757, the betrayal of Mir Jafar resulted in the defeat of Nawab Siraj-ud-Daulah to the British East India Company and eventual British dominance across South Asia.

Under Mughal rule, eastern Bengal continued to prosper as the melting pot of Muslims in the eastern subcontinent and attracted traders from around the world. The region was unified into an independent, unitary Bengal Sultanate. Sufi missionary leaders like Sultan Balkhi, Shah Jalal and Shah Makhdum Rupos helped in spreading Muslim rule. Becoming part of the Delhi Sultanate, three city-states emerged in the 14th century with much of eastern Bengal being ruled from Sonargaon.

The Muslim conquest of Bengal began in 1204 when Bakhtiar Khalji overran northern Bengal and invaded Tibet. The Mauryan, Gupta, Pala, Sena, Chandra and Deva dynasties were the last pre-Islamic rulers of Bengal. Ancient Bengal was an important cultural centre in the Indian subcontinent as the home of the states of Vanga, Pundra, Gangaridai, Gauda, Samatata, and Harikela. The country has a Bengali Muslim majority. The official language is Bengali, one of the easternmost branches of the Indo-European language family.īangladesh forms the sovereign part of the historic and ethnolinguistic region of Bengal, which was divided during the Partition of India in 1947. Chittagong, the largest seaport, is the second-largest city. Dhaka, the capital and largest city, is the nation's economic, political, and cultural hub. It is narrowly separated from Bhutan and Nepal by the Siliguri Corridor and from China by 100 km of the Indian state of Sikkim in the north. Bangladesh shares land borders with India to the west, north, and east, and Myanmar to the southeast to the south it has a coastline along the Bay of Bengal. It is the eighth-most populous country in the world, with a population exceeding 163 million people in an area of either 148,460 square kilometres (57,320 sq mi) or 147,570 square kilometres (56,980 sq mi), making it one of the most densely populated countries in the world.
